MUMBAI, India, Sept. 26 -- Intellectual Property India has published a patent application (202411020762 A) filed by Teerthanker Mahaveer University, Moradabad, Uttar Pradesh, on March 19, 2024, for 'adaptable eyelash-extension application assistive device.'

Inventor(s) include Anand Joshi.

The application for the patent was published on Sept. 26, under issue no. 39/2025.

According to the abstract released by the Intellectual Property India: "An adaptable eyelash-extension application assistive device, comprising an elongated frame 1 having a proximal end 2 and a distal end 3, pair of rods for connecting ends, handle 4 accessed by user to position the frame 1 near the user's eye, AI based imaging unit 5 determines dimension of the user's eye, transparent lid for covering the user's eye, microphone 6 for enabling the user to provide input voice specifications regarding an operation that the user desire to be formed on the user's eye, chamber 8 for storing adhesive, electronically controlled nozzle 7 for dispensing nozzle 7 on the user's eyelids, telescopically operated link 9 to apply adhesive on the user's eyelids, robotic gripper 10 to paste extension of user's eyelids, motorized sliding unit 13 to translate plates 12 towards each other for assisting in eyelash extension curling."
